Chapter 7: Programming

DIAG

This command runs a diagnostics test to verify system functioning and pinpoint errors.

To run the diagnostics test, type diag following an ISACC prompt.

ISACC>diag

Crystal = 14.7456Mhz

Board rev = C/D/E

Software version = 3.37

Max int stack = 151

Min ext stack = 24539

Max int time = 5734

Min int time = 4166

Avg int time = 4188

C run time = 0 mS

Start ups = 1

ROM test:PASS

Internal RAM test:PASS

External RAM test:PASS, PASS

Analog input test:PASS

Phone test:NO DIAL TONE

Reset ?

ISACC>

Crystal speed, board revision, and software revision

- used for factory identification.

Max internal stack, min internal stack, max interrupt time, min interrupt time, and
avg interrupt time

- refer to memory usage and processing times. These are internal moni-

toring elements that are important for factory referral.

C execution time

- indicates the duration time of the C program, if one is running.

Start ups

- indicates the number of times the unit has been powered up or reset.

ROM test, internal RAM test, and external RAM test

- these tests evaluate different

sections of memory. Each are either PASS or FAIL

Analog input test

- determines ISACC's ability to read analog information from the inputs.

It is either PASS or FAIL.

Phone test

- determines if there is a dial tone or not.

Reset?

- (y/n) This is the remote equivalent of turning ISACC off then on again. There is no

loss of programming information.
